The Nike Air Max 90 Sports Patriotic “Thunder Blue” Accents

For years, the Nike Air Max 90 and Air Max 95 were partners in crime, each some of the most accessible products in the Nike catalog, tacitly paired together as they filled out endless seasonal catalogs. Yet with Sergio Lozano’s design celebrating its 30th anniversary, we’re beginning to see a bit of separation between the two — at least for now. Capping off 35 years in its own right, the Air Max 90 has remained a serious factor in GR slate amid its counterpart’s foray into the hype market, again the case with a “Pale Ivory/Thunder Blue” edition on the way.

Eschewing the “Infrared” style blocking that we so often see flipped by successive AM90s, instead this pair starts off with a refined foundation of “Pale Ivory” mesh and suede, paired with a gum sole underfoot. A “Thunder Blue” mudguard and fiery red branding help bring the Fourth of July atmosphere we allude to in the title, an everlasting combination elsewhere in the catalog but delivered in blocking that feels refreshing for Tinker Hatfield’s invention.

The Nike Air Max 90 “Thunder Blue” releases as a part of Nike’s ongoing Summer/Fall 2025 efforts, checking in at $140. Check out official images below and watch our Sneaker Release Dates page for additional info in the coming weeks.
